14-year-old boy on bicycle dies following crash in East Gwillimbury

A York Regional Police cruiser. File / Global News

York Regional Police say a 14-year-old boy riding his bicycle has died after a collision with another vehicle in East Gwillimbury.

Police said the crash happened at around 2:41 p.m. Sunday near Doane Road and Centre East.

Investigators said the boy tragically died as a result of the collision.

The driver remained at the scene, police said.

The major collision unit has taken over the investigation.
